Discover the Fascinating Monuments of Delhi
The journey commences in Delhi, the heart of India — a city that beautifully unites the old with the new. A walk across its ancient streets reveals an array of iconic landmarks and lively bazaars. Visitors can witness the architectural brilliance of the Qutub Minar, Humayun’s Tomb, and Red Fort, each representing different eras of India’s glorious past. The imposing India Gate, the tranquil Lotus Temple, and the grandeur of Rashtrapati Bhavan reflect the modern capital’s vibrancy.
Exploring Old Delhi is an experience in itself — from the fragrant alleys of Chandni Chowk to the peaceful aura of Jama Masjid. This part of the city transports visitors to the Mughal era, where winding lanes, colourful bazaars, and local eateries tell stories of heritage and tradition. Meanwhile, New Delhi reflects a modern sophistication, with broad roads, fashionable shops, and a cosmopolitan lifestyle.
Witness the Timeless Splendour of Agra
The next destination in the Golden Triangle tour is Agra, home to one of the Seven Wonders of the World — the breathtaking Taj Mahal. Built by Emperor Shah Jahan in memory of his beloved wife Mumtaz Mahal, this marble masterpiece symbolises eternal love and architectural perfection. Watching the Taj Mahal illuminate under the rising sun or glisten in the moonlight is a sight that enchants all who behold it.
Beyond the Taj Mahal, Agra features several other heritage marvels such as the Agra Fort and the tomb of Itimad-ud-Daulah, often referred to as the “Baby Taj.” A short drive from the city brings visitors to Fatehpur Sikri, the former capital of Emperor Akbar, which now stands as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. The intricate carvings, grand gateways, and exquisite courtyards of these monuments display the creative genius of the Mughal dynasty.
In addition to its historical significance, Agra is also known for its local crafts, stone craftsmanship, and mouth-watering local dishes, making it a paradise for art lovers and gastronomes alike.
Unveil the Royal Grandeur of Jaipur
Completing the triangle, Jaipur — the capital of Rajasthan — enchants visitors with its royal elegance and colourful traditions. Often called the “Pink City,” Jaipur captivates travellers with its majestic forts, bustling markets, and architectural marvels. The city’s perfect mix of tradition and artistry makes it a must-visit destination in every Delhi Agra Jaipur tour package.
Among Jaipur’s crown jewels are the majestic Amber Fort, perched high on a hill with awe-inspiring views of the Aravalli Range, and the City Palace, an impressive fusion of Rajput and Mughal architecture. The Hawa Mahal, with its honeycomb-like structure, and the Jantar Mantar, an astrological marvel, demonstrate the scientific and artistic achievements of the region.
Shopping in Jaipur is a joy for visitors, offering everything from ethnic artefacts and gemstones to fabrics and ceramics. The city’s bustling markets, like Johari Bazaar and Bapu Bazaar, embody the colourful spirit of Rajasthan, while its local cuisine — from dal bati churma to ghewar — serves a flavourful feast for every palate.

Ideal Itinerary for a Delhi Agra Jaipur Tour
A typical Delhi Agra Jaipur tour covers five to seven days, commencing in Delhi. Travellers usually spend a day exploring the capital’s heritage before travelling to Agra via the Yamuna Expressway. After marvelling at the Taj Mahal and Agra Fort, the journey moves onward to Jaipur, where vibrant traditions and majestic forts await. The final leg of the trip often features local markets and performances in Jaipur before returning to Delhi for departure.
This itinerary guarantees travellers to experience every highlight — from Delhi’s colonial legacy to Agra’s romantic aura and Jaipur’s cultural vibrancy. Some packages also offer optional activities such as elephant rides at Amber Fort, light and sound shows, or cultural performances to enrich the journey’s richness.
Ideal Season to Visit the Golden Triangle
The most pleasant period to embark on a Golden Triangle journey is between October and March, when the weather remains pleasant for sightseeing and outdoor activities. The mild temperatures and bright days during these months elevate the experience of exploring palaces, forts, and monuments comfortably. Summers, though warmer, can suit travellers who prefer fewer crowds.
